Whether removal detention was permissible despite alleged impossibility of forced removal to Iran
Extrahierter Entscheid
Detention was only justified to secure the consular interview and a prompt reassessment; a three-month detention was disproportionate because removal could not be expected in the near future.
Extrahierte Begründung
Under Art. 13c(5)(a) ANAG detention ends or is impermissible when removal proves legally or factually impossible. Here the record showed that involuntary return to Iran was generally blocked, and the authorities could only justify detention briefly to enable the planned consular appearance and then reassess the situation.
